Professor Martin, Vice-Chancellor of the University of New South Wales, Visits XJTU, Deepening Mutual Cooperation
On March 26, Prof. Iain Martin, vice-chancellor in charge of academic affairs of the University of New South Wales, visited XJTU along with his colleagues and discussed methods to further expand communication platformand deepen mutual cooperation. President Wang Shuguo met with these guests in Room 201 of the Science Hall with Vice-President Wang Tiejun, Academician Jiang Zhuangde and Director of the Department of International Cooperation and Exchange and the School of Management, as well as professors representing related specialties.
At the end of this meeting, President Wang sent an invitation to the University of New South Wales and Xinjiang University for setting up a new League of Universities along the Silk Road, so as to enhance higher education cooperation and jointly build a brighter future.
